The Department of Defense, specifically the Department of the Air Force, is seeking interested institutions or contractors to provide Combat Air Force Airmanship Services through a Request for Information (RFI). The primary objective is to identify contractors with aircraft suitable for aviation operations that can support flying currency for qualified USAF pilots, with services required to be accessible within 30 minutes of any USAF Fighter Wing. This initiative is crucial for maintaining pilot proficiency and enhancing airmanship without the need for major modifications to the aircraft, which must comply with FAA regulations for Civil Aircraft Operations. Interested parties are encouraged to submit a two-page description of their capabilities, including the number of aircraft and any relevant FAA Airworthiness Certificates, to the primary contact, Jeremy Young, at jeremy.young.19@us.af.mil.
